The cost of living in Melbourne is 33% more expensive than in Memphis. Cities ranked 933rd and 2436th ($2356 vs $1769) in the list of the most expensive cities in the world and ranked 4th and 1929th in Australia and the United States, respectively. Check Australia vs the United States comparison.

The average after-tax salary is enough to cover living expenses for 1.6 months in Melbourne compared to 2.3 months in Memphis. Melbourne ranked 1st best city to live in Australia vs Memphis ranked 39th in the United States, while ranked 2nd and 173rd among best cities to live in the world.
